Rodem Church is a community of faith that upholds God’s Word, standing as Noah’s Ark in an age where the dam has broken and the flood has come—restoring the church’s identity and purpose to fulfill the will of the Lord.
Evangelism
Proclaiming the gospel of forgiveness to the ends of the earth is the Great Commission of our Lord (Matthew 28:20). To fulfill this sacred calling, we devote ourselves to both domestic and international missions, with particular emphasis on mission partnerships through Ohana, the matching of missionaries with mission fields, and outreach activities through mission teams. In addition, Rodem Church belongs to the Global Methodist Church, and together with churches within this denomination across the United States and around the world, we are united in establishing mission centers and carrying out evangelistic ministry.
Worship
Rodem Church is founded upon the grace shown to Elijah, who, in his spiritual weariness, found rest and restoration under the broom tree through the angel of the Lord (1 Kings 19:5–8). Empowered by God’s comfort and saving grace, our mission and identity are to fulfill the final calling, moving from worship within the sanctuary to a life of worship in all that we do.
Education & Discipline
Jesus said to Peter three times, “Feed my sheep” (John 21:15–17). In the same way, nurturing believers can never be overemphasized. Rodem Church is committed to the lifelong spiritual growth and maturity of each soul, not through temporary or short-term discipleship, but through continual formation over a lifetime. This begins with the foundation of first nourishing oneself with the spiritual food of God’s Word and prayer before feeding others.
Service
The early church community did not neglect caring for one another and sharing fellowship in the Lord (Acts 2:46–47). Above all, Rodem Church is called to tenderly care for those who have been wounded and are in need of healing, sharing the love and compassion of Jesus by meeting not only spiritual needs but also physical ones through mutual support and care.
Military Ministry
Rodem Church’s military ministry fulfills its calling to serve God, people, and the nation through the vocation of active-duty soldiers. Centered on military personnel gathered in Hawaii and deployed around the world, this ministry builds community, fosters fellowship, and supports military families as they transition to new environments. Formed within the unique context of military life, this ministry serves as a vital channel for missions, keeping us connected as one community wherever we are called to serve.
